New Ship Load Window in 1.9


After a short holiday I’m back working on 1.9.0. The first improvement in this version will be a completely revised window for loading ships. Up to 1.8.0, when you go to the “File” menu and select “Load Ship” a quite dull window will open to allow you to navigate to a folder on your computer and select files suitable to be used as ships in Floating Sandbox (.shp and .png files). Especially .shp files look quite dumb as Windows doesn’t have a clue of what they contain.

This will all be different in 1.9.0. The new window will show a preview of all ship files, together with measurements and some metadata - author, year the ship was built on, etc. Check this preview out:
